Semiconductor firm SMSC has introduced the USB553x, a family of USB 3.0 hub controllers that the company says deliver the "hybrid speed" configuration with an optimised BOM cost for designers.

The new family of USB controllers consisting of 7-port and a 4-port offerings features programmable flexibility for configuration of performance enhancing features, and the ability to support 2-layer PCB designs.

The USB553X family is designed for USB port expansion in docking stations, port replicators, all-in-one monitors, as well as peripheral hubs for use with ultra-mobile PCs, tablets and notebooks.

SMSC senior director of Marketing Mark Fu said with the added bandwidth inherent in the SuperSpeed version, USB 3.0 is capable of aggregating audio, video, storage and human interface data over a single USB connection on a PC.

"Our 7-port hub, the USB5537, is well suited for a USB docking station requiring all of these capabilities," Fu said.

When used in a standalone USB hub box, the USB5537 provides four USB 3.0 ports and three USB 2.0 ports from one USB connection to a USB host system.

The USB5537 features PortMap, PortSwap, VariSense, PHYBoost, and USB Battery Charging 1.2, and handles embedded USB connections with ease and provides designers the flexibility to meet the industry’s stringent USB certification requirements.

Both USB5537 and USB5534 retain SMSC’s MultiTRAK technology for High Speed USB traffic, which provides a dedicated pipeline, or a transaction translator (TT), for every downstream full-speed device.

Fu said, "In addition to meeting commercial design requirements, the USB553x family is also available in an industrial temperature grade that meets -40 degree C to 85 degree C operating conditions."
